Computer Science and Information Systems at New York University Course Introduction
New York University (NYU) offers a Master of Science in Information Systems (MSIS) that integrates computer science and business education through its Courant Graduate School of Arts and Science and Stern School of Business. The program prepares students for management roles that require both technical and business acumen. Students engage in real-world projects through the Information Technology Project course, collaborating with local organizations. The curriculum includes courses from both schools, ensuring a comprehensive understanding of technology and business strategy. Graduates are well-equipped for careers in various sectors, including IT, consulting, and software development.

New York University Financial Aid & Scholarships
New York University (NYU) is committed to making education accessible and affordable, offering a range of financial aid options to meet the diverse needs of its students. NYU provides need-based financial aid, merit-based scholarships, and work-study opportunities. The university meets a significant portion of demonstrated financial need, with an average financial aid package of approximately $37,000 per year. NYU's financial aid programs are designed to support both domestic and international students, ensuring that financial barriers do not hinder educational pursuits. Students can apply for aid through the FAFSA and CSS Profile, with additional support available for families earning under $60,000 annually.
